Include files in systemverilog

WebJul 13, 2010 · SystemVerilog considers these two class definitions unequal types because they have different names, even though their contents, or class bodies, are identical. The … WebCo-Founder, Tetra Logic Infotech Pvt Ltd Author has 101 answers and 336.4K answer views 5 y. Yes you can use `include for including package, but using import for including the …

SystemVerilog Assertions Basics - SystemVerilog.io

WebJun 21, 2024 · When you `include a file, it is basically saying take the contents of that file and paste it at the location of the include statement. This is effectively the same … WebFPGA architecture An introduction to System Verilog, including its distinct features and a ... tested and speed-up is measured. Downloadable files include all design examples such as basic processor synthesizable code for Xilinx and Altera tools for PicoBlaze, MicroBlaze, Nios II and ARMv7 architectures in VHDL and Verilog code, as well as ... easy football quiz questions and answers uk https://jimmypirate.com

Digital Design With Verilog And Systemverilog [PDF]

WebJul 15, 2024 · The SystemVerilog compiler looks for names locally. If they are not found, it goes to the “grocery store”, which is the package. When you compile this module, the … Weband a comparison of Verilog with System Verilog A project based on Verilog ... Verilog Coding Style: files vs. modules, indentation, and design organisation; Design Work: … Webinclude systemverilog file in verilog testbench I want to include a systemverilog file in my verilog testbench, but some error apears `timescale 1ns/10ps `include … cure shaky hands

library - What is the use of

Category:11. Packages — FPGA designs with Verilog and SystemVerilog …

Tags:Include files in systemverilog

Include files in systemverilog

Digital Design With Verilog And Systemverilog [PDF]

WebHow can I use a Verilog HDL header file that contains only parameter... Use the `include directive to include all your header files within the module … WebSystemVerilog Synthesis Support. Quartus® Prime synthesis supports the following Verilog HDL language standards: The following important guidelines apply to Quartus® Prime synthesis of Verilog HDL and SystemVerilog: The Compiler uses the SystemVerilog standard for files with the extension of .sv . If you use scripts to add design files, you ...

Include files in systemverilog

Did you know?

WebSystem Verilog allows us to read and write into files in the disk. How to open and close a file ? A file can be opened for either read or write using the $fopen () system task. This task will return a 32-bit integer handle called a file descriptor. This handle should be used to read and write into that file until it is closed. WebOct 16, 2011 · 1. if you do not specify a path to the included file, then modelsim compiler assumes the file is located in the same folder from which you are running the compile. You can specify an include folder on the command line as - vlog module_to_be_compiled +incdir+C:/SDRAM_controller_ModelSim_test 2.

Weband a comparison of Verilog with System Verilog A project based on Verilog ... Verilog Coding Style: files vs. modules, indentation, and design organisation; Design Work: instruction set architecture, external bus ... in the design of the digital system using Verilog HDL. The Verilog projects include the design module, the test bench module ... WebJun 24, 2024 · set_global_assignment -name VERILOG_CU_MODE MFCU . ... Macros from a different file CAN be defined with SFCU, but only using `include macro. SFCU is required for Quartus to auto-sort the compilation order of files. It's rational - in order the determine the compilation order, each file should be viewed separately by Quartus (It's as …

WebThe scripts source add all the files (IS_GLOBAL_INCLUDE 1 is set for all of them). The scripts also update the compile order. Everything compiles into a single library in Vivado. stfarley (Customer) 4 years ago Thanks Vivian. The files are … WebHow can I use a Verilog HDL header file that contains only parameter... Use the `include directive to include all your header files within the module body.When synthesizing header files in the Quartus® II software, do not add the header file to the list of files in the Qu

WebJul 15, 2024 · The package store. The SystemVerilog compiler looks for names locally. If they are not found, it goes to the “grocery store”, which is the package. When you compile this module, the wildcard import statement tells the compiler that the package is a place to find definitions. The compiler does not bring in all the names from the package.

WebOct 18, 2013 · `include "codec_package.v" in verilog module ( within module). but while analysis and synthesis, the compiler is giving error saying "Error (10170): Verilog HDL syntax error at codec_package.v (7) near text "endmodule"; expecting ")". module codec_package ( ~~~~ ~~ Function declaration ~~~ endmodule easy footing formsWebIn a system verilog file(file1), 1st : I am including a verilog file using `include "file2.v" and then, 2nd : I am including another systemverilog file using `include "file3.sv". Now the file3 … easy foot soak recipeWebSystemVerilog Assertions (SVA) is essentially a language construct which provides a powerful alternate way to write constraints, checkers and cover points for your design. It … cure shingles in 3 daysWebAug 11, 2024 · If you want them in the same file: Code: module a ( input x, output y ); assign y = x; endmodule module b ( input m, output n ); a a_inst ( .x (m), .y (n) ); endmodule but having multiple modules in one file is a bad practice. The general rule you should follow is one module per file. Aug 10, 2024 #5 A asdf44 Advanced Member level 4 easy football trivia with answersWebAug 18, 2024 · The data structure types may further include design specifications 1240, characterization data 1250, verification data 1260, design rules 12110, and test data files 1285 which may include input test patterns, output test … cure shortness of breathWebIn this section, we will create a testbench for ‘my_package.sv’ file; and use the keyword ‘include’ to use the package in it. 11.4.1. Modify my_package.sv ¶ In Listing 11.3, the wildcard import statement is added at the Line 17, which is … cure shortsWebOct 6, 2024 · We suggest the following procedure to include files from other projects in SystemVerilog. Files that are not in any project (e.g. a reference library) can be included in the same way. 1. Organize include files in IP projects . In the IP block project or sub-project, organize all include files that you want to include from outside the project in ... cure shingles fast